Peer-to-Peer streaming systems (or P2P-TV) have been studied in the literature for some time, and are being considered as the most promising approach to deliver real-time video to large scale users over the Internet. Neighbor selection is one of the key components to construct overlay topology for P2P streaming system. The common QoS-awareness neighbor selection algorithms in existing overlay construction schemes usually select a fixed number of neighbors which satisfy the selection requirements, such as end-to-end delay or a peer's upload bandwidth.
